Florian Paul & die Kapelle der letzten Hoffnung

In the organizer's words:

Florian Paul is a storyteller. He tells of life, of love, of loneliness, of big themes in small events, with a smoky voice and grand gestures like an old drunk trying to explain the world from the bar. Together with the "Kapelle der letzten Hoffnung", consisting of Johannes Rothmoser (drums), Giuliano Loli (keys), Nils Wrasse (saxophone) and Susi Lotter (bass), he creates an incomparably versatile, energetic sound that is new and yet full of nostalgia. Their concerts are recreation, liberation, a place of longing and food for thought. They are theater and club visit in one. Wild, dreamy, virtuosic and simply beautiful.

As usual, their program poses big questions about meaning, love and the challenges of an uncertain future. "Just you and me in an ideal world that is falling apart around us" is the title of one of the new songs - a description of a state of mind. Look forward to an evening full of danceable melancholy.
